Avery is no stranger to bullying; not only from within his own home, but from his classmates as well. He assumed once he started college, his peers would mature and his worries would be over, but he couldn't be more wrong; rude remarks and hurtful words turn to physical altercations, and Avery needs to learn to protect himself.
Troy, a retired heavyweight boxer, is awestruck when a gorgeous young man enters the gym where he works as a trainer. Troy immediately takes Avery on as a client, and after one lesson, he's drawn to do more than teach and protect him.
But Avery has to protect his heart as well as his body, and has built walls which Troy must climb to discover secrets and surprising shared needs. If they're willing to fight for each other, their love could be a knockout.
This low angst story is full of sweet moments and steam. It contains no cheating or cliffhangers and has a very happy HEA!
*Trigger warning — this story contains instances of body shaming and mention of physical and sexual assault.

This book was very sweet but also very tragic. It had wonderful characters that were perfect for each other despite their differences. It's low steam with no rel angst but lots of drama. I absolutely would have loved a longer book with the relationship developed more but I'm use to this author's tendency to write short stories and this was a great one. The forcus is more on Averys character development and overcoming his horrible past which was definitely achieved by the end.
The narrator did a wonderful job with the narration as always. He expressed all the emotions wonderfully and brought the story to life. He gave all the characters their own distinct voices that suited them all perfectly and made the story easy to follow. It is always a pleasure listening to them narrate this author's stories.
